Environmental Policy
In the wake of the growing awareness and effects of global warming, resource depletion, and pollution levels worldwide, green construction has developed as a means of improving building practices so that they do not harm the environment. There are many different components that go into green construction, including adherence to eco-friendly construction methods and practices, sustainable sourcing of materials, energy and water efficiency, improving waste management, recycling, etc.
In its quest for a sustainable earth, Mackintosh Corporation realizes that a holistic approach is needed. The use of eco-friendly and sustainable materials is not enough. Corporate commitment, sustainable practices at the office and on-site, as well as the continued orientation of personnel at all levels, are further key components. Mackintosh Corporation therefore firmly commits to all aspects of sustainability and environmental action.

Actions Taken in Promotion and Realization of the Green Statement
Appointment of Environmental Officer
Vice President Danny Valera, a Certified BERDE Professional (CBP), was appointed as Environmental Officer and is in charge of environmental programs and training.
Office
- Recycle policy
- Policy to distribute documents electronically in lieu of printing
- Use of recycled paper where available
- Policy for archiving documents electronically
- Responsible waste management program
Site
- Recycling, waste management, and responsible disposal policy
- Promotion and use of eco-friendly materials
- Use of construction peripherals from sustainable sources
- Site training of workers in green construction practices
- Compliance with safety standards and practices
Waterproofing Materials
- Promotion of Green Certified waterproofing materials
- Use of low VOC materials
- Advocacy to change material specification from harmful to eco-friendly
Training
- Provision of ongoing training in sustainable construction practices to professional and key personnel
- Ongoing safety training for professional and key personnel
- Ongoing training of workers in green construction and safety practices
